ant编译的时候,报错文件不存在,以及版本不一致

Posted 云儿且行且珍惜

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了ant编译的时候,报错文件不存在,以及版本不一致相关的知识,希望对你有一定的参考价值。

ant编译的时候,

1. 报错:D:\software\apache-tomcat-7.0.2\lib does not exist.
解决办法:需要更改目录,build.properties 文件中,
tomcat.home=当前使用的tomcat的路径,例如 D:\\software\\apache-tomcat-7.0.1
java.home=当前使用的java的bin路径,例如 D:\\java1.6\\bin
都配置成使用的正确的路径

2. 报错:java.lang.UnsupportedClassVersionError: com/sun/tools/javac/Main : Unsupported major.minor version 52.0
原因及解决办法:是因为java JRE版本不一致,更改JRE 路径为正确的。可以参考上一篇随笔,更改eclipse的java版本。

以上是关于ant编译的时候,报错文件不存在,以及版本不一致的主要内容,如果未能解决你的问题,请参考以下文章

httpclient与httpcore版本不匹配导致的编译问题

ubuntu 16.0 利用ant编译 hadoop-eclipse-plugins2.6.0

用netbeans开发自由格式项目时,编译报错“程序包不存在”以及相应的“找不到符号”。

错误记录:vue跟vue编译器版本不一致

java程序用Eclipse打包的时候出现资源与文件系统不一致怎么解决?

java 编译中文件名和类名不一致的问题